141018-30-6 50mg
1400755-05-6 50mg
187-83-7 25mg
2435-85-0 50mg
1795791-38-6 5mg
2.5mg
25354-97-6 2mL
21643-38-9 100mg
34338-96-0 1g
688-99-3 50mg